NEW to the second edition:
- Completely updated chapter on the Verification of Spatial Forecasts taking account of the wealth of new research in the area
- New separate chapters on Probability Forecasts and Ensemble Forecasts
- Includes new chapter on Forecasts of Extreme Events and Warnings
- Includes new chapter on Seasonal and Climate Forecasts
- Includes new Appendix on Verification Software
